About Quinn
Quinn is a name that effortlessly blends modern appeal with a rich, ancient heritage. Originally an Old Irish surname meaning "descendant of Conn (chief)," it carries an understated strength and a friendly, approachable vibe. Perfect for parents seeking a name that feels both current and rooted, Quinn offers a bold yet simple elegance. Its unisex nature adds to its contemporary charm, making it a versatile choice for any child. Unlike many short, punchy names, Quinn manages to feel both sophisticated and down-to-earth, never veering into overly cutesy territory. It's a name that suggests confidence and an easygoing spirit, reflecting its rising popularity across English-speaking countries.

Frequently Asked Questions About Quinn
Is Quinn traditionally a boy's or girl's name?
Quinn is a truly unisex name, popular for both boys and girls, reflecting its modern and versatile appeal.
What does the name Quinn mean?
Quinn originates from Old Irish, meaning "descendant of Conn," where Conn itself means "chief" or "wise."
